> If I have a path-like structure called "base.path",
> 
>   <path id="base.path">
>   <fileset dir="lib">
>   <include name="**/*.jar"/>
>   </fileset>
>   </path>
> 
> How can I referencing "base.path" directly in <war> task or it's
> nested <lib> element?

WAR task specifies in the documentation that : 

"The nested lib element specifies a FileSet. All files included in this
fileset will end up in the WEB-INF/lib directory of the war file."

So try : 
<lib refid="base.path">

Actually if you are using modern IDE (like IDEA) to edit your build.xml
typing "<lib" should fire-up all possible options to auto-complete.
